Yes, Best Buy Totaltech covers pet damage, including damage caused by chewing. This includes earbuds, chords, and any other eligible product that is covered by the Totaltech membership.
According to the Best Buy Totaltech terms and conditions, the membership covers "accidental damage from handling, including drops, spills, and cracks." This also includes damage caused by pets.
To file a claim for pet damage, you can visit a Best Buy store or call the Geek Squad at 1-888-BESTBUY (1-888-237-8289). You will need to provide proof of your Totaltech membership and the damaged product.
Once your claim is approved, Best Buy will either repair or replace the damaged product, depending on the extent of the damage. If the product cannot be repaired, Best Buy will replace it with a new or comparable product.

It is important to note that there are some exclusions to the Best Buy Totaltech coverage. For example, the membership does not cover lost or stolen products, or damage caused by intentional abuse.
